WHY DID SHE LEAVE HIM?, by                    
First Line: "why did she leave him, they grew up together"
Last Line: Why did she leave him? - because he was poor
Subject(s): Beauty;grief;poverty; Sorrow;sadness


Why did she leave him, they grew up together,
Near to the old church on the bright village green,
Never to part in amusing weather,
Ellen and Edward in childhood were seen;
She had not wealth, but her beauty commanded
Suitors, alas! who could riches secure;
But when her hand as his bride he demanded,
Why did she leave him? -- because he was poor.

He was once mild, young, and gay-hearted,
First in the frolic of market or fair;
White are the cheeks whence the smile has departed,
Others may revel, but he cannot share;
Bright are the eyes that around him are beaming,
Cold is the heart that strives to adhere,
Save when at night on the past he is dreaming.
Why did she leave him? -- because he was poor.

Now she rides by in her pride and her carriage,
But where is the bloom that once shone on her cheek?
Haughty and proud are the friends of her marriage,
Now she must feel what she dare not speak.
She perchance smiles for her earliest hours,
Grieves for the sorrows that he must endure,
And would give up the world for a wreath of wild flowers.
Why did she leave him? -- because he was poor.
